#7f70da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7f70da is composed of 49.8% red, 43.9%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.7% cyan, 48.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 248.5 degrees, a saturation of 58.9% and a lightness of 64.7%. #7f70da color hex could be obtained by blending #fee0ff with #0000b5.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#7f70da

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05030d is the darkest color, while #fdf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#7f70da

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a2a0aa is the less saturated color, while #664dfd is the most saturated one.
